  5. I don't believe that, unless the new way is signing into a random "room" for several hours, being shown random books with no grades, and hoping something I want shows up. It is all about FOMO not building one's collection. If I want a specific book -- to check out different grades and prices and scans -- Whatnot cannot do that. It shows you, maybe, what is available live at that specific time (if they setup their listings fully, which most do not do). From a selling perspective I like how Whatnot forces (?) a buyer to have a payment method ready so someone doesn't skip out; as a buyer, I don't have hours a day (or even per week) to hope something comes along I want -- even if it's an amazing deal. Time is more valuable than that deal.
